SOC 15-1255 (Web and Digital Interface Designers) is the dedicated UX/UI code BLS introduced in 2018 — distinct from 27-1024 (Graphic Designers, $61,300 median) and 15-1254 (Web Developers).

Starting Your user experience design Career in Laconia
Employers in Laconia who actively recruit new UX design graduates primarily include local tech companies, digital agencies, and in-house product teams. While larger firms may not have a strong presence, smaller agencies can offer valuable opportunities through project diversity and tailored experiences. Aspiring designers should focus on building a solid portfolio, as this often carries more weight than formal education. Possessing a relevant bachelor’s degree in design or human-computer interaction can provide a competitive edge, and familiarity with tools such as Figma and Adobe Creative Suite remains essential. In the current market, new graduates might find their starting pay in NH influenced by their versatility, with higher salaries reserved for those who specialize in rapidly growing areas, like design systems, particularly amid a backdrop of layoffs that have reshaped the tech employment scene in recent years. As they progress, it is realistic to anticipate steady salary growth in their first few years, which can lead to a more lucrative career as they develop their skills and expertise.
